For decades, public health messaging suggested that moderate alcohol consumption—particularly red wine—might offer cardiovascular protection. This narrative has fundamentally changed in 2025 as researchers have identified critical flaws in earlier studies and accumulated more comprehensive data on alcohol's health impacts.
Stanford Medicine researchers emphasize that individual health factors significantly influence alcohol's effects, prompting calls for reevaluating guidelines on drinking and health (Stanford Medicine). The famous "French Paradox"—the observation that French populations had lower heart disease rates despite higher wine consumption—failed to account for:
• Genetic variations in alcohol metabolism between populations
• Lifestyle confounders like Mediterranean diet patterns, walking culture, and stress levels
• Selection bias in studies that compared moderate drinkers to abstainers without distinguishing former heavy drinkers from lifelong non-drinkers
The International Agency for Research on Cancer has been clear about alcohol's carcinogenic properties, with recent publications focusing on reduction or cessation strategies (IARC Publications). Unlike cardiovascular disease, where risk curves show some complexity, cancer risk appears to increase linearly with alcohol consumption:
• Breast cancer: Risk increases by 7-10% per drink per day
• Liver cancer: Risk doubles with 2-3 drinks daily over 10+ years
• Colorectal cancer: 15-20% increased risk with moderate consumption
• Head and neck cancers: Synergistic effects with tobacco use
While the protective effects of moderate drinking have been largely debunked, the cardiovascular risk profile shows more complexity than cancer risk. Recent meta-analyses suggest:
• No protective effect for coronary heart disease in most populations
• Increased stroke risk even at moderate consumption levels
• Blood pressure elevation starting at 1-2 drinks per day
• Atrial fibrillation risk increases significantly with any regular consumption

Research has identified several effective approaches for managing alcohol cravings, regardless of whether you're pursuing moderation or abstinence. Imaginal retraining has been evaluated as effective in people with strong cravings for alcohol, providing a new self-help technique that can be customized to individual problems (Clinical Neuropsychology).
Cognitive techniques:
• Urge surfing: Observing cravings without acting, knowing they peak and subside
• Cognitive restructuring: Challenging thoughts that lead to drinking
• Mindfulness meditation: Developing awareness of triggers and responses
• Imaginal retraining: Visualizing successful resistance to drinking urges
Behavioral strategies:
• Environmental modification: Removing alcohol from easily accessible locations
• Activity scheduling: Planning engaging alternatives during high-risk times
• Social support activation: Reaching out to supportive friends or family
• Emergency planning: Having specific steps to take when cravings are intense

The conversation around alcohol and health is evolving globally, with different regions taking varying approaches to public health messaging and policy.
Adults in the WHO European Region consume an average of 9.2 litres of pure alcohol per year, making them the heaviest drinkers globally (WHO Europe). This high consumption rate contributes to significant health burdens:
• Alcohol is responsible for nearly 800,000 deaths annually in the European region
• Deaths are largely from noncommunicable diseases such as cardiovascular disease and cancer
• Implementing evidence-based policies is crucial to safeguard public health (WHO Europe)

A comprehensive review of current and emerging trends in alcohol use disorder treatment reveals that despite AUD's substantial impact—contributing to over 140,000 annual deaths and over 200 related diseases and health conditions globally—it remains undertreated, marked by a scarcity of approved medications (Psychology Today).
AUD accounts for 5.1% of the global disease burden, highlighting the need for more effective treatment options and prevention strategies (Psychology Today).
